SCDPS announces increase of law enforcement for New Year holiday travel
COLUMBIA, S.C. (WOLO)– Starting on December 29-January 1 motorist across South Carolina will see additional enforcement on the road, said the SC Department of Public Safety.
The SC Department of Public Safety said over the next few days special enforcement during the official New Year holiday travel period will be conducted.
South Carolina Highway Patrol and State Transport Police will focus on enforcing all traffic violations with an importance on speeding, seatbelt usage, distracted driving, aggressive driving, and impaired driving.
